Is there a role for Ytrrium-90 in the treatment of unresectable and metastatic intrahepatic cholangiocarcinoma?

Am J Surg. 2018 Mar;215(3):467-470. doi: 10.1016/j.amjsurg.2017.11.022. Epub 2018 Feb 2.

Abstract

Background: Selective internal radiation therapy (SIRT) with Ytrrium-90 (Y-90) has been used to treat hepatic malignancies with success. This study focuses on the efficacy and safety of Y-90 in the treatment of unresectable and metastatic intrahepatic cholangiocarcinoma (ICC).

Methods: A single-institution retrospective case review was performed for patients with unresectable and metastatic ICC treated with Y-90 between 2006 and 2016.

Results: Seventeen patients with ICC underwent 21 Y-90 treatments. Four patients had undergone prior liver resection, and six patients had extrahepatic disease at the time of treatment. Five year overall survival was 26.8%, with a median survival of 33.6 months. One patient underwent margin negative liver resection after a single treatment. Complications were appreciated in two cases. Ninety-day mortality was 0%.

Conclusion: Treatment of ICC using Y-90 is a safe and promising procedure. Further research is needed to clarify its role in the treatment of unresectable and metastatic ICC.
